Libya, December 1941: bombs from Bristol Blenheim Mark IVs of No. 270 Wing RAF explode among Junkers Ju 52s German transport aircraft parked on the landing ground at El Magrun, Libya, in the afternoon of 22 December 1941. Blenheims, from Nos, 14 and 84 Squadrons RAF and the Lorraine Squadron of the Free French Air Force, made a series of attacks on El Magrun on 21-22 December 1941, which was being used extensively by the Luftwaffe to provide air support for their retiring ground forces during operation Operation Crusader made by the British Eighth Army between 18 Novembe-30 December 1941 which relieved the siege of Tobruk.
